Although smoke alarm are referred to as "reduced voltage," it does not mean that there isn't severe danger when servicing the devices. Inappropriate handling of the wiring can result in serious shock, burns, and internal organ damages. If you really feel uncomfortable by any means servicing the electric circuitry, it is best to ask an expert to aid with the setup or substitute.

Set up smoke detectors on every degree of the building, consisting of cellars and inside or near workspace. Detectors positioned in hallways and stairwells are likewise advised. Proper placement guarantees the whole residential or commercial property is covered in case of a fire.

Prevent corners and vents where airflow might interrupt smoke discovery. Likewise, stay clear of mounting detectors near home windows and or places that produce severe temperature levels. Special tools can be used in those situations. Smoke detectors should be checked monthly, and a specialist assessment ought to be scheduled yearly. Depending on market or special regulations, even more regular evaluations might be called for.

Many home owners appreciate taking on Do it yourself projects around the residence. When it comes to electric job, the threats can be major.

Incorrect wiring can lead to electrical fires. Loose connections or overloaded circuits can cause cables to overheat and capture fire.
